     I have seen one Realtor locally that is an Ecobroker, and I have
visited their website. But I don't know what an Ecobroker is yet. Are
they promoting the EEM's (Energy Efficient Mortgage's), green building
programs, or what? I do know that there is effort here in California to
develop a Green Mortgage, it will be tied to GreenPoints, and it may or
may not work with other green building programs too. LEED for homes is
working with Fanie Mae. And RESNET (www.resnet.org) which was created
because of the EEM is working to change the program so that is more
valuable and used more. People are working to get GreenPoints in the
Multiple Listing Service. The energy savings are what justifies
mortgage, not the other green items.
